.pillars-section{background-color:#6b7b3c0d;padding:100px 0}.pillar-icon{color:var(--primary-color);margin-top:4px;font-size:1.5rem}.pillar-title{color:var(--primary-color);margin-bottom:8px;font-size:1.35rem;font-weight:700}.pillar-desc{color:#555;font-size:1rem;line-height:1.6}.pillars-section .section-header-top{text-transform:uppercase;letter-spacing:2px;color:var(--secondary-color);margin-bottom:12px;font-size:.9rem;font-weight:700}.pillars-section .section-header-title{color:var(--primary-color);font-size:2.25rem;font-weight:700;line-height:1.3}.pillars-section .section-header-divider{background-color:var(--primary-color);width:70px;height:3px;margin-top:15px}@media (max-width:991px){.pillars-section{padding:80px 0}}
.strategic-approach-section{background-color:#fff;padding-top:120px;padding-bottom:120px;position:relative;overflow:hidden}.strategic-approach-section .container{z-index:2;position:relative}.approach-image-wrapper{width:100%;max-width:500px;margin:0 auto;position:relative}.approach-image-wrapper img{border:1px solid #6b7b3c1a;border-radius:12px;box-shadow:0 20px 40px #0000001a}.approach-badge{background-color:var(--primary-color);color:#fff;z-index:3;border-radius:8px;padding:15px 25px;position:absolute;bottom:-20px;right:-30px;box-shadow:0 10px 20px #0003}.approach-badge p{text-transform:uppercase;letter-spacing:1px;font-size:.9rem;font-weight:600;color:#fff!important;margin-bottom:0!important}.strategic-approach-content{padding-left:20px}.approach-subtitle{color:var(--secondary-color);text-transform:uppercase;letter-spacing:2.5px;margin-bottom:15px;font-size:.9rem;font-weight:700;display:block}.approach-title{color:var(--primary-color);margin-bottom:25px;font-size:2.5rem;font-weight:700;line-height:1.25}.approach-divider{background-color:var(--primary-color);width:80px;height:3px;margin-bottom:30px}.approach-description p{color:#555;margin-bottom:20px;font-size:1.05rem;line-height:1.8}.feature-cards-grid{grid-template-columns:repeat(2,1fr);gap:20px;margin-top:40px;display:grid}.approach-card{background-color:var(--light-bg-color);border-left:4px solid var(--primary-color);border-radius:12px;height:100%;padding:25px;transition:all .3s}.approach-card:hover{border:1px solid var(--primary-color);border-left:4px solid var(--primary-color);background-color:#fff;transform:translateY(-5px);box-shadow:0 10px 20px #0000000d}.card-title{color:var(--primary-color);margin-bottom:10px;font-size:1.15rem;font-weight:700}.card-desc{color:#666;margin-bottom:0;font-size:.95rem;line-height:1.5}@media (max-width:991px){.strategic-approach-section{padding-top:80px;padding-bottom:80px}.strategic-approach-content{margin-top:60px;padding-left:0}}@media (max-width:768px){.approach-title{font-size:2rem}.feature-cards-grid{grid-template-columns:1fr}.approach-badge{bottom:-10px;right:10px}}
